Feasibility study for the creation of a methanation unit in the Bretagne Romantique territory

The community of communes Bretagne Romantique has decided to hire a reflection for the creation of a methanization unit on its territory by valuing the surplus of biomass and thus contributing to the overall project of reducing the fossil: energy consumption. A field study was conducted by contacting, either directly or using a questionnaire, the leading actors of biomass production, such as farmers and municipalities of the territory but also neighboring towns. In order to upgrade the products derived from methanization (heat biogas, digestate), a study was conducted in parallel with industries and several municipalities. The results of the study supported the idea that a project of scale was feasible on the sector, as the increase of obligation of purchase in May 2011 and the Energy Performance Plan allow us to consider either the development of a project involving around ten houses in these Structural Surplus Zones, or the implantation of a higher-power digester. Location is still to be defined depending on the area of input production and heat recovery. (author)
